President: over 1,500 Strike drones launched by Russia this week, hundreds of thousands of families remain without power

Emergency restoration work continues in Ukraine following massive Russian attacks on energy infrastructure. Hundreds of thousands of families in a number of regions remain without electricity, heating, and water supply.

This was reported by President of Ukraine Volodymyr Zelenskyy.

Consequences of strikes on energy infrastructure 

According to the Head of State, since yesterday all relevant services have been working to restore electricity, heating, and water supply to regions affected by Russian strikes. The most difficult situation remains in Mykolaiv, Odesa, Kherson, Chernihiv, Donetsk, Sumy, and Dnipropetrovsk regions.

The President thanked energy workers and repair crews involved in eliminating the consequences of the attacks.

Volodymyr Zelenskyy also reported that overnight Russia again struck Ukrainian communities. As a result of the shelling, there are wounded.

Scale of Russian attacks over the week

The Head of State emphasized that Russia is deliberately prolonging the war and seeking to inflict as much damage as possible on the civilian population.

“In total, this week alone, the Russians launched more than 1,500 strike drones, nearly 900 guided aerial bombs, and 46 missiles of various types at Ukraine. Just one week”, — the statement said.

Diplomatic efforts and expectations of results 

The President stressed that Ukraine needs peace on dignified terms and is ready to work as constructively as possible on the diplomatic track. The coming days, he said, will be filled with diplomatic contacts.

Volodymyr Zelenskyy expressed hope for support from international partners and thanked everyone who is helping Ukraine.
